Detailed explanation-2: -Before you can think about programming a computer, you need to work out exactly what it is you want to tell the computer to do. Thinking through problems this way is Computational Thinking. Computational Thinking allows us to take complex problems, understand what the problem is, and develop solutions.

Detailed explanation-3: -Decomposition– breaking down a complex problem or system into smaller, more manageable parts.
